API Design for C++. Martin Ry

API Design for C++


API.Design.for.C..pdf
ISBN: 0123850037,9780123850034 | 446 pages | 12 Mb


Download API Design for C++



API Design for C++ Martin Ry
Publisher: Morgan Kaufmann




FW: API Design for C++ (Repost). вот например дочитал давеча subj. Like any complex task, it tests the limits of our attention and memory. After reviewing hundreds of actual SaaS APIs, many up to par and others distinctly . Even though I live in the C++ world as opposed to Java, 99% of this is directly applicable. With this book, you will learn how to design a good API for large-scale long-term projects. Similar to the pilots' pre-flight checklist, this list helps software designers remember obvious and not so obvious rules while designing Java APIs. API Design for C++ Martin Ry ebook. This library is an effort to support cloud-based client-server communication in native code using a modern asynchronous C++ API design. As a result, APIs are not well designed or properly built and wind up costing both the vendor and its customers tens of thousands of dollars in ongoing maintenance due to infrastructure costs and the drain on engineering resources. The latest C++11 Standard was a brave attempt, after many years of neglect, at catching up with the reality of concurrent programming. Casablanca is a Microsoft incubation effort to support cloud-based client-server communication in native code using a modern asynchronous C++ API design. There are many different rules and tradeoffs to consider during Java API design. API Design for C++ by Martin Ry. Language: English ISBN: 0123850037, 9780123850034. Subject: API Design for C++ (Repost) Martin Reddy, "API Design for C++" English | 2011-02-18 | ISBN: 0123850037 | 472 pages | FW: Score Magazine - 2011 11. With extensive C++ code to illustrate each concept, API Design for C++ covers all of the strategies of world-class API development. Http://www.apibook.com/blog/archives/95 API Design for C++. Если бы автор был честен, то книжка была бы крайне короткой - на пару примерно таких предложений: Application Binary Interface in C++ is compiler specific. For several years Gecko used a C++ wrapper around cairo as its cross-platform rendering API. Asynchronous API in C++ and the Continuation Monad.